These data comprise bills of materials, photographs and drawings describing the Delamination Detector developed in Research Study Number 2-18-68-130 by the Texas Transportation Institute, Texas A&M University in cooperation with the Texas Highway Department. This study was sponsored jointly by the Texas Highway Department and the Department of Transportation, Federal Highway Administration. The information is presented in eight sections, each related to a separate portion of the apparatus. The drawings comprise assembly and detail-part shop sketches which will aid technicians experienced in the construction of mechanical and electronic instruments to duplicate the Delamination Detector. The materials indicated on the individual drawings are summarized and specified in the bills of materials to facilitate procurement. The Delamination Detector is covered by a pending United States patent application.
